WebJan 31, 2024 · Thistle plaster: This brand name from British Gypsum but has become shorthand for a finish coat and can be used on plasterboard, or as part of a two-coat system. Carlite plaster: Also used as a finishing coat and suitable for a wide range of substructures, this type of plaster takes longer to set than Thistle. WebThis Thistle bonding coat from British Gypsum is a multi-coat plaster ideal for smooth and low suction backgrounds, including medium density blocks, dense blocks, plasterboard, painted or tiled surfaces and more. The plaster comes with a finer mix giving great workability and making it easier to apply. Easy to apply with no tools needed.

WebThistle SprayFinish plaster helps you get bigger jobs finished faster by spraying skim onto walls before flattening it to a smooth finish. It's designed for skim finishing large wall areas using a spray machine to automatically mix and apply the finishing plaster more quickly.
